Valentine’s Day is the perfect opportunity to express your love through food. Whether you’re cooking for a partner, friend, or even yourself, creating a romantic meal can help set the mood for a special evening. Here are ten delightful recipes to impress your loved one this Valentine’s Day.
1. Heart-Shaped Pancakes
Start the day with a whimsical breakfast! Make pancakes using a heart-shaped mold or simply pour the batter in a heart shape on the skillet.
- Ingredients: flour, baking powder, sugar, milk, eggs, vanilla, and butter.
- Tip: Serve with fresh strawberries and maple syrup for an extra romantic touch!
2. Spaghetti Aglio e Olio
This classic Italian dish is a favorite among couples. Its simplicity and rich flavors make it the perfect romantic dinner.
- Ingredients: spaghetti, garlic, red pepper flakes, parsley, and olive oil.
- Tip: Pair it with a glass of red wine for an authentic Italian experience!
3. Strawberry and Goat Cheese Salad
This refreshing salad combines sweet strawberries with creamy goat cheese, drizzled with balsamic glaze.
- Ingredients: mixed greens, strawberries, goat cheese, walnuts, and balsamic vinegar.
4. Classic French Onion Soup
Warm and comforting, this soup is a perfect starter for a romantic evening. The sweetness of the caramelized onions paired with melted cheese will surely delight.
- Ingredients: onions, beef broth, butter, thyme, and cheese.
- Tip: Serve in individual oven-safe bowls for a beautiful presentation!
5. Lobster Tail with Garlic Butter
This luxurious dish is not only delicious but also looks stunning on the plate. Perfect for a special occasion!
- Ingredients: lobster tails, butter, garlic, lemon, and parsley.
- Tip: Serve with a side of asparagus for an elegant meal.
6. Chocolate Fondue
No romantic meal is complete without dessert! Chocolate fondue allows you to dip fresh fruits, marshmallows, and more into a pot of melted chocolate.
- Ingredients: dark chocolate, heavy cream, strawberries, bananas, and marshmallows.
- Tip: Use a variety of fruits to make it colorful and fun!
7. Baked Salmon with Lemon and Dill
Light yet flavorful, baked salmon is a healthy option that doesn’t skimp on taste.
- Ingredients: salmon fillets, lemon, dill, garlic, and olive oil.
- Tip: Pair with roasted vegetables for a nutritious side!
8. Chicken Marry Me! Pasta
This creamy pasta dish gets its name from the idea that it’s irresistible. It combines the rich flavors of sun-dried tomatoes and spices.
- Ingredients: chicken breast, pasta, sun-dried tomatoes, garlic, and cream.
- Tip: Sprinkle Parmesan cheese on top for added flavor!
9. Red Velvet Cake
A classic Valentine’s dessert, this moist cake topped with cream cheese frosting is both beautiful and delicious.
- Ingredients: flour, cocoa powder, buttermilk, eggs, and cream cheese.
- Tip: Decorate with red sprinkles for an extra festive look!
10. Romantic Raft of Sorbet
Lighten the mood with a fruity sorbet, perfect for cleansing the palate after a rich meal.
- Ingredients: fresh fruit (like mango or raspberry), sugar, and water.
- Tip: Serve in elegant dishes with mint leaves to garnish!

FAQs
1. Can I prepare these recipes in advance?
Many of these recipes can be made ahead of time, especially the soups and desserts. Just follow storage instructions to keep them fresh!
2. What should I serve as drinks?
Wine is a classic choice for a romantic dinner, but you might also consider cocktails or a non-alcoholic beverage like sparkling water with fruit slices.
3. Are these recipes suitable for vegetarians?
Some recipes can be easily modified to be vegetarian. For example, swap the chicken in the pasta for mushrooms or tofu, and use vegetable broth in soups.
4. What if I have food allergies?
Always consider dietary restrictions. Make substitutions based on allergies, such as using gluten-free pasta or nut-free spreads.
5. How can I make the dining experience more romantic?
Set the table with candles, flowers, and soft music to create an inviting atmosphere. Personal touches like hand-written notes can also enhance the experience.
